Is there free parking in Springdale, UT, USA?

Is there free parking in Springdale, UT, USA?

For visitors heading to the Town's shopping and dining areas, paid public on-street parking is available on SR-9 across from the Post Office (0.2 miles to downtown shops and restaurants). Also, several shops and restaurants offer free parking for their patrons.

Where do you park your car at Zion National Park?

Finding Parking and Entering Zion: If you are planning on driving into Zion National Park for the day, note that the primary parking lot for Zion Canyon is located at the Visitor Center just inside the southern entrance of the park, but this lot typically fills up by mid-morning on high visitation days.

Can you drive your car in Zion National Park?

While you can only drive through Zion Canyon in your own car a few months out of the year, you can always drive the Mount Carmel Highway. This 12-mile highway connects the south and east entrances of Zion National Park, and driving it is an experience in itself. ... Make sure to allow extra time for this drive.

What is the best entrance to Zion National Park?

Zion National Park Visitor Centers

The Zion Canyon Visitor Center is located at the south entrance of the park near Springdale. The Kolob Canyon Visitor Center is located off of Interstate 15 at the west entrance of the park.
